Address

1PedvTcbech2YTzNAgpk5Eex8iLdG5yKXz
Confirmed tx count
34
Confirmed received
29 outputs (0.42168099 BTC)
Confirmed spent
28 outputs (0.42167401 BTC)
Confirmed unspent
1 output (0.00000698 BTC)

25 of 34 Transactions